|
@@ -1,54 +1,176 @@
|
|
|
-CREATE DATABASE Coffee DEFAULT C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ci;
|
|
|
-
|
|
|
-CREATE TABLE IF NOT EXISTS user (
|
|
|
-userID int(11) NOT NULL AUTO_INCREMENT,
|
|
|
-datetime TIMESTAMP NOT NULL DEFAULT current_timestamp() COMMENT '紀錄時間',
|
|
|
-firstname varchar(30)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'姓氏',
|
|
|
-lastname varchar(30)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'名字',
|
|
|
-mail varchar(256)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'電子郵件',
|
|
|
-phone varchar(20)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'連絡電話',
|
|
|
-username varchar(30)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'使用者名稱',
|
|
|
-password varchar(40)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'密碼',
|
|
|
-status int(11) NOT NULL COMMENT '0:admin;1:superuser;2:enduser;8:new;9:disable',
|
|
|
-PRIMARY KEY(userID)
|
|
|
-)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_unicode_ci;
|
|
|
-
|
|
|
-INSERT INTO user (firstname, lastname, mail, phone, username, password, status) VALUES
|
|
|
-('firstname', 'lastname', 'aaa@gmail.com', '0987654321', 'user', '123456', 1);
|
|
|
-
|
|
|
-
|
|
|
-
|
|
|
-
|
|
|
+CREATE DATABASE Coffee DEFAULT C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ci;
|
|
|
+use Coffee;
|
|
|
+
|
|
|
+CREATE TABLE IF NOT EXISTS user (
|
|
|
+userID int(11) NOT NULL AUTO_INCREMENT,
|
|
|
+datetime TIMESTAMP NOT NULL DEFAULT current_timestamp() COMMENT '紀錄時間',
|
|
|
+firstname varchar(30)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'姓氏',
|
|
|
+lastname varchar(30)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'名字',
|
|
|
+mail varchar(256)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'電子郵件',
|
|
|
+phone varchar(20)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'連絡電話',
|
|
|
+username varchar(30)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'使用者名稱',
|
|
|
+password varchar(40)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'密碼',
|
|
|
+status int(11) NOT NULL COMMENT '0:admin;1:superuser;2:enduser;8:new;9:disable',
|
|
|
+PRIMARY KEY(userID)
|
|
|
+)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_unicode_ci;
|
|
|
+
|
|
|
+INSERT INTO user (firstname, lastname, mail, phone, username, password, status) VALUES
|
|
|
+('firstname', 'lastname', 'aaa@gmail.com', '0987654321', 'user', '123456', 1);
|
|
|
+
|
|
|
+-- CREATE TABLE IF NOT EXISTS dry_tank_actuator(
|
|
|
+-- sn int(11) NOT NULL AUTO_INCREMENT COMMENT '流水號',
|
|
|
+-- datetime tim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'紀錄時間',
|
|
|
+-- tank_num varchar(3) NOT NULL COMMENT '乾燥槽編號(D1~D12)',
|
|
|
+-- vacuum tinyint(1) NOT NULL DEFAULT '0' COMMENT '真空吸料機',
|
|
|
+-- threewayvalve_input tinyint(1) NOT NULL DEFAULT '0' COMMENT '吸料機三通閥',
|
|
|
+-- solenoid_disinfect tinyint(1) NOT NULL DEFAULT '0' COMMENT '消毒閥',
|
|
|
+-- motor int(11) NOT NULL DEFAULT '0' COMMENT '馬達',
|
|
|
+-- solenoid_outer_water tinyint(1) NOT NULL DEFAULT '0' COMMENT '桶外進水電磁閥',
|
|
|
+-- solenoid_water_out tinyint(1) NOT NULL DEFAULT '0' COMMENT '廢水排水電磁閥',
|
|
|
+-- heater1 tinyint(1) NOT NULL DEFAULT '0' COMMENT '加熱管 1',
|
|
|
+-- heater2 tinyint(1) NOT NULL DEFAULT '0' COMMENT '加熱管 2',
|
|
|
+-- temp_enable tinyint(1) NOT NULL DEFAULT '0' COMMENT '溫控開關',
|
|
|
+-- temp float NOT NULL DEFAULT '0' COMMENT '設定溫度',
|
|
|
+-- diskvalve tinyint(1) NOT NULL DEFAULT '0' COMMENT '蝴蝶閥',
|
|
|
+-- switch_magnetic tinyint(1) NOT NULL DEFAULT '0' COMMENT '電磁開關',
|
|
|
+-- switch_emergency tinyint(1) NOT NULL DEFAULT '0' COMMENT '緊急開關',
|
|
|
+-- camera tinyint(1) NOT NULL DEFAULT '0' COMMENT '攝影機',
|
|
|
+-- light_warning tinyint(1) NOT NULL DEFAULT '0' COMMENT '警示燈',
|
|
|
+-- PRIMARY KEY (sn)
|
|
|
+-- )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_unicode_ci;
|
|
|
+
|
|
|
+-- INSERT INTO dry_tank_actuator (tank_num, vacuum, threewayvalve_input, solenoid_disinfect, motor, solenoid_outer_water, solenoid_water_out, heater1, heater2, temp_enable, temp, diskvalve, switch_magnetic, switch_emergency, camera, light_warning)
|
|
|
+-- VALUES ('D13',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0');
|
|
|
+
|
|
|
+-- CREATE TABLE IF NOT EXISTS dry_tank_SHT11(
|
|
|
+-- sn int(11) NOT NULL AUTO_INCREMENT COMMENT '流水號',
|
|
|
+-- datetime tim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P COMMENT '紀錄時間',
|
|
|
+-- tank_num varchar(3) NOT NULL COMMENT '乾燥槽編號(D1~D12)',
|
|
|
+-- SHT11_Temp varchar(16) NOT NULL DEFAULT '0' COMMENT 'SHT11 溫度 (單位℃)',
|
|
|
+-- SHT11_Humidity varchar(16) NOT NULL DEFAULT '0' COMMENT 'SHT11 濕度 (單位%)',
|
|
|
+-- PRIMARY KEY (sn)
|
|
|
+-- )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_unicode_ci;
|
|
|
+
|
|
|
+-- INSERT INTO dry_tank_SHT11 (tank_num, SHT11_Temp, SHT11_Humidity) VALUES ('D13', '0', '0')
|
|
|
+
|
|
|
+--
|
|
|
+-- -----------------------------------------------------------------------------------------------------------
|
|
|
+--
|
|
|
+
|
|
|
+CREATE DATABASE Sixth DEFAULT C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ci;
|
|
|
+use Sixth;
|
|
|
+
|
|
|
+--
|
|
|
+-- 資料表結構 `farm_info`
|
|
|
+--
|
|
|
+
|
|
|
+CREATE TABLE `farm_info` (
|
|
|
+ `sn` int(11) NOT NULL,
|
|
|
+ `path` text NOT NULL,
|
|
|
+ `location` text NOT NULL,
|
|
|
+ `loc_lat` text NOT NULL,
|
|
|
+ `loc_lng` text NOT NULL,
|
|
|
+ `user_id` int(11) DEFAULT NULL,
|
|
|
+ `datetime` datetime NOT NULL
|
|
|
+)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4;
|
|
|
+
|
|
|
+--
|
|
|
+-- 資料表的匯出資料 `farm_info`
|
|
|
+--
|
|
|
+
|
|
|
+INSERT INTO `farm_info` (`sn`, `path`, `location`, `loc_lat`, `loc_lng`, `user_id`, `datetime`) VALUES
|
|
|
+(6, '0', 'Statue of Liberty', '40.6892500000001', '-74.04445', 1, '2021-01-26 11:32:48');
|
|
|
+
|
|
|
+-- --------------------------------------------------------
|
|
|
+
|
|
|
+--
|
|
|
+-- 資料表結構 `node_img`
|
|
|
+--
|
|
|
+
|
|
|
+CREATE TABLE `node_img` (
|
|
|
+ `sn` int(11) NOT NULL,
|
|
|
+ `node_name` varchar(10) NOT NULL,
|
|
|
+ `path` text NOT NULL,
|
|
|
+ `user_id` int(11) DEFAULT NULL,
|
|
|
+ `datetime` datetime NOT NULL
|
|
|
+)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4;
|
|
|
+
|
|
|
+--
|
|
|
+-- 資料表的匯出資料 `node_img`
|
|
|
+--
|
|
|
+
|
|
|
+INSERT INTO `node_img` (`sn`, `node_name`, `path`, `user_id`, `datetime`) VALUES
|
|
|
+(1, 'Nr.1', 'app/static/farm_img\\benson\\1.jpg', 1, '2020-12-24 11:20:08'),
|
|
|
+(2, 'Nr.2', 'app/static/farm_img\\benson\\2.jpg', 1, '2020-12-24 11:20:08'),
|
|
|
+(3, 'Nr.3', 'app/static/farm_img\\benson\\3.jpg', 1, '2020-12-24 11:20:08'),
|
|
|
+(4, 'Nr.4', 'app/static/farm_img\\benson\\4.jpg', 1, '2020-12-24 11:20:08'),
|
|
|
+(5, 'Nr.5', 'app/static/farm_img\\benson\\5.jpg', 1, '2020-12-24 11:20:08'),
|
|
|
+(6, 'Nr.6', 'app/static/farm_img\\benson\\6.jpg', 1, '2020-12-24 11:20:08'),
|
|
|
+(7, 'Nr.7', 'app/static/farm_img\\benson\\7.jpg', 1, '2020-12-24 11:20:08'),
|
|
|
+(8, 'Nr.8', 'app/static/farm_img\\benson\\8.jpg', 1, '2020-12-24 11:20:08'),
|
|
|
+(9, 'Nr.9', 'app/static/farm_img\\benson\\9.jpg', 1, '2020-12-24 11:20:08'),
|
|
|
+(10, 'Nr.10', 'app/static/farm_img\\benson\\10.jpg', 1, '2020-12-24 11:20:08'),
|
|
|
+(11, 'Nr.11', 'app/static/farm_img\\benson\\11.jpg', 1, '2020-12-24 11:20:08');
|
|
|
+
|
|
|
+-- --------------------------------------------------------
|
|
|
+
|
|
|
+--
|
|
|
+-- 資料表結構 `sensor_list`
|
|
|
+--
|
|
|
+
|
|
|
+CREATE TABLE `sensor_list` (
|
|
|
+ `sn` int(11) NOT NULL,
|
|
|
+ `ch_name` varchar(20) NOT NULL,
|
|
|
+ `en_name` varchar(20) NOT NULL,
|
|
|
+ `version` varchar(10) NOT NULL,
|
|
|
+ `datetime` datetime NOT NULL
|
|
|
+)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4;
|
|
|
+
|
|
|
+--
|
|
|
+-- 資料表的匯出資料 `sensor_list`
|
|
|
+--
|
|
|
+
|
|
|
+INSERT INTO `sensor_list` (`sn`, `ch_name`, `en_name`, `version`, `datetime`) VALUES
|
|
|
+(1, '空氣溫度', 'airTem', 'v1.0', '2021-01-20 16:27:59'),
|
|
|
+(2, '空氣濕度', 'airHum', 'v1.0', '2021-01-20 16:45:09'),
|
|
|
+(3, '露點', 'dewPoint', 'v1.0', '2021-01-20 16:45:33'),
|
|
|
+(4, '日照', 'sun', 'v1.0', '2021-01-20 16:46:17'),
|
|
|
+(5, '土壤含水率', 'soilHum', 'v1.0', '2021-01-20 16:46:42'),
|
|
|
+(6, '土壤溫度', 'soilTem', 'v1.0', '2021-01-20 16:46:59'),
|
|
|
+(7, '土壤EC值', 'soilEC', 'v1.0', '2021-01-20 16:47:30'),
|
|
|
+(8, '風速', 'windSpd', 'v1.0', '2021-01-20 16:47:58'),
|
|
|
+(9, '風向', 'windDin', 'v1.0', '2021-01-20 16:48:20'),
|
|
|
+(10, '降雨量', 'rain', 'v1.0', '2021-01-20 16:48:45'),
|
|
|
+(11, '大氣壓', 'atmosphere', 'v1.0', '2021-01-20 16:49:06'),
|
|
|
+(19, '酸鹼值', 'PH', 'v1.0', '2021-01-21 14:57:20'),
|
|
|
+(20, '超音波', 'sonic', 'v2.0', '2021-01-21 15:02:06'),
|
|
|
+(21, '水位', 'water level', 'v1.0', '2021-01-21 16:42:55'),
|
|
|
+(22, '光速', 'light', 'v1.0', '2021-01-21 16:44:17'),
|
|
|
+(23, '美女', 'girl', 'v1.0', '2021-01-21 17:45:41'),
|
|
|
+(24, '自由女神', 'Statue', 'v1.0', '2021-01-26 10:58:37'),
|
|
|
+(25, '帥哥', 'handsome', 'v1.0', '2021-01-28 17:52:31');
|
|
|
+
|
|
|
+-- --------------------------------------------------------
|
|
|
+
|
|
|
+--
|
|
|
+-- 資料表結構 `user`
|
|
|
+--
|
|
|
+
|
|
|
+CREATE TABLE `user` (
|
|
|
+ `sn` int(11) NOT NULL,
|
|
|
+ `firstname` varchar(30) NOT NULL,
|
|
|
+ `lastname` varchar(30) NOT NULL,
|
|
|
+ `mail` varchar(50) NOT NULL,
|
|
|
+ `phone` varchar(20) NOT NULL,
|
|
|
+ `username` varchar(30) NOT NULL,
|
|
|
+ `password` varchar(40) NOT NULL,
|
|
|
+ `status` int(11) NOT NULL COMMENT '0:admin,1:new,2:old',
|
|
|
+ `isActive` tinyint(1) NOT NULL
|
|
|
+)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4;
|
|
|
+
|
|
|
+--
|
|
|
+-- 資料表的匯出資料 `user`
|
|
|
+--
|
|
|
+
|
|
|
+INSERT INTO `user` (`firstname`, `lastname`, `mail`, `phone`, `username`, `password`, `status`, `isActive`) VALUES
|
|
|
+('firstname', 'lastname', 'aaa@gmail.com', '0123456789', 'user', '123456', 2, 1);
|